2. Ingredients for Crispy Sweet Potato Fries
- 2 large sweet potatoes, peeled and cut into fry-shaped strips
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on cumin
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
- Optional: a pinch of cayenne pepper for heat
3. Step-by-Step Instructions to Make Oven Baked Sweet Potato Fries
Choose the Right Sweet Potatoes
Select firm, evenly sized sweet potatoes for uniform cooking. Rinse and peel them before cutting into fry shapes.
Cut and Prepare the Fries
Cut the sweet potatoes into evenly sized fry-shaped pieces to ensure they cook uniformly. Toss them in a large bowl with olive oil, spices, salt, and pepper.
Preheat Your Oven
Set your o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at for easy cleanup.
Arrange the Sweet Potato Fries
Spread the fries evenly on the prepared baking sheet in a single layer. Avoid overcrowding for maximum crispiness.
Bake Until Crispy
Bake for about 25-30 minutes, flipping them halfway through, until they are golden brown and crispy.
Serve Hot and Crispy
Once baked, sprinkle with additional salt if desired. Serve immediately with your favorite dipping sauces or as part of a healthy meal.
4. Tips for the Perfect Crispy Sweet Potato Fries
- Ensuring even cuts helps the fries cook uniformly.
- Using a high-quality oven or convection setting enhances crispiness.
- Spacing the fries out on the baking sheet is key to achieving a crispy exterior.
5. Storage and Reheating Techniques for Leftover Sweet Potato Fries
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. To reheat, place them on a baking sheet and bake at 375°F (190°C) until crispy again. For quick reheats, use an air fryer for best results.

7. Common Questions About Crispy Oven Baked Sweet Potato Fries
Can I make these fries gluten-free?
Absolutely! These healthy sweet potato fries are naturally gluten-free. Just ensure any seasoning blends are gluten-free.
What are good substitutes for olive oil?
You can also use coconut oil, avocado oil, or spray oil for a lower calorie option.
Preparation time?
The total time for preparing, baking, and serving these crispy sweet potato fries is approximately 40 minutes.
